🛠️ Stack Behind the Scenes

Layer Tech / Service Why it was chosen
Runtime Intelligence OpenAI GPT-4o Fast, reliable, and robust for real-time reasoning
Agentic Logic Rig Lightweight, modular framework for orchestrating tool-calling LLM agents
Web / API Rust + Axum Performant, type-safe HTTP layer
Serverless Deploy Shuttle Zero-config, Rust-native deployments
Database Neon (Postgres) Serverless with branching for safe experimentation
Authentication Supabase Quick auth flows & session handling
Embeddings mxbai-embed-large-v1 via Ollama (local) → Hugging Face (cloud) Cheap to build locally, scalable remotely
Debugging Copilot Claude 4 Sharp and contextual sanity checks

🧩 Internals

Key Files

  • src/main.rs – Axum route /generate-plan, sets up the Rig agent and forwards the user objective.
  • src/tools.rs – Implements two Rig tools:
    • query_vivatech_api → Hits the external RAG endpoint to search sessions/partners.
    • assess_event_timeliness → Parses dates & classifies urgency (Immediate / Soon / Normal).
  • src/models.rs – Domain models (GeneratePlanRequest, VivatechSource, etc.).

Env Vars Used

Variable Required Purpose
OPENAI_API_KEY Calls GPT-4o for planning logic
VIVATECH_API_URL Endpoint for VivaTech RAG search
API_TIMEOUT_SECONDS HTTP timeout for external calls
CONFERENCE_DATE Override reference date for tools

🌐 Companion Services

This repo focuses on the planning micro-service, but two other services complete the picture:

Service Purpose Env Var / URL
VivaTech RAG Agent Exposes a /query endpoint that talks directly to the Postgres + embeddings DB. Our query_vivatech_api tool calls this private service to fetch relevant sessions & partner info. VIVATECH_API_URL (e.g. https://vivatechblablabla.shuttle.app/query) (private)
Session Manager / Queue A minimal private front-end layer that handles session token issuance, rate-limiting, and a small in-memory FIFO queue so we don't overload GPT-4. Think "traffic cop" for end-users. Live at https://vivatech.remo-lab.com/ (private)

The front-end session manager is available publicly at https://vivatech.remo-lab.com/. It is intentionally kept thin—HTML + a sprinkle of JS—so it can be swapped or scaled independently (Cloudflare Workers, Vercel Edge, etc.). For now it simply meters requests and shows a "you're in line" screen if usage spikes.
